The integration of Power BI and ChatGPT brings together the power of data analytics and conversational AI, creating a dynamic combination that can revolutionize the way organizations extract insights from their data.   Users will now be able to engage in natural language conversations with their data, making it more accessible and intuitive for decision-makers at all levels. This dynamic combination will empower businesses to uncover hidden patterns, trends, and correlations in their data, leading to actionable insights and strategic advantages in today’s competitive landscape.  Let’s explore how this powerful duo can change how we interact with data. 

Power BI Overview 

Power BI is a robust business intelligence and data visualization tool developed by Microsoft. It empowers organizations to transform raw data into meaningful insights and compelling visualizations. Power BI offers a suite of features and functionalities that enable users to connect to various data sources, create interactive dashboards, and share reports across the organization. With its user-friendly interface and powerful analytical capabilities, Power BI has become a leading choice for businesses seeking to leverage their data for informed decision-making. 

Key Features and Capabilities  

Power BI encompasses a wide range of features and capabilities designed to facilitate data analysis and visualization. Some key features include: 
  1. Data Connectivity:
  2. Power BI allows users to connect to a diverse range of data sources, including databases, cloud services, spreadsheets, and more. This ensures seamless integration of data from multiple systems, enabling comprehensive analysis.
  3. b) Data Modeling: Power BI provides a robust data modeling environment where users can shape, transform, and combine data from different sources. This capability allows for the creation of a unified and consistent view of the data, facilitating accurate analysis and reporting.
  4. c) Visualizations: Power BI offers a rich library of visualizations, including charts, graphs, maps, and tables. Users can choose from a variety of customizable visuals to represent their data in a visually compelling and informative manner.
  5. d) DAX Language: The Data Analysis Expressions (DAX) language in Power BI enables advanced calculations, data manipulation, and formula-based expressions. This powerful language allows users to create complex measures, calculated columns, and calculated tables to derive meaningful insights from the data.

Importance of Data Visualization and Analytics  

Power BI’s emphasis on data visualization empowers users to gain insights quickly and effectively. By presenting data visually through charts, graphs, and interactive dashboards, Power BI enhances data comprehension, enabling users to identify patterns, trends, and outliers.  Furthermore, Power BI enables users to go beyond simple visualization and perform in-depth data analysis. With features like filtering, slicing, and drill-down, users can explore the data from various angles, uncover hidden insights, and make data-driven decisions. This helps organizations to respond promptly to changing market conditions and capitalize on opportunities. 

What is ChatGPT? 

ChatGPT is an advanced conversational AI model developed by OpenAI. It is built upon the GPT (Generative Pre-trained Transformer) architecture, which has been trained on a vast amount of text data to generate human-like responses in natural language. ChatGPT has the capability to understand and generate text-based conversations, making it an ideal tool for creating interactive and dynamic conversational experiences. 

What can we expect from this integration – Power BI + ChatGPT 

By integrating Power BI and ChatGPT, businesses can unlock powerful conversational analytics, enabling intuitive data exploration and actionable insights through natural language interactions. Let’s explore a few advantages of this powerful combination. 

1. Improved Anomaly Detection and Monitoring  

Power BI’s advanced visualizations combined with ChatGPT’s conversational interface enable users to quickly identify unusual patterns or outliers. Users can ask ChatGPT to analyze the data for anomalies, and the model can provide real-time insights and alerts. Organizations can proactively address potential issues and take immediate corrective actions. 

2. Natural Language Insights and Explanations  

Users can ask ChatGPT questions about specific data points, trends, or correlations, and receive human-like explanations in plain language. This capability enhances data comprehension for users who may not have extensive technical knowledge, enabling them to gain deeper insights from the data and make informed decisions. This also promotes self-service analytics, reducing the dependency on data analysts or specialists for data interpretation. 

3. Predictive Analytics and What-If Analysis  

ChatGPT can assist in building predictive models, conducting scenario simulations, and exploring hypothetical scenarios based on user inputs. Users can leverage Power BI’s data visualization capabilities to visualize the predicted outcomes and analyze the impact of different variables. This helps with data-driven forecasts, assess potential risks, and making informed decisions based on predictive insights.

4. Improved Data Governance and Compliance

ChatGPT can act as a virtual assistant to help users adhere to data governance policies, ensuring that data access, sharing, and usage comply with regulatory requirements. ChatGPT can provide guidance on data sensitivity, privacy rules, and access controls, promoting responsible data handling and mitigating the risks of data breaches or non-compliance.

5. Intelligent Data Exploration and Recommendations 

ChatGPT can leverage its understanding of user preferences, historical data interactions, and contextual insights to suggest relevant visualizations, related data points, or alternative data perspectives. This intelligent recommendation system facilitates data discovery, uncovers hidden patterns, and encourages users to explore different angles of analysis. 

6. Enhanced Data Security and Privacy 

ChatGPT can enforce access controls, authenticate users, and ensure secure data interactions within the Power BI environment. Additionally, ChatGPT can assist in detecting and flagging potential data privacy risks, such as sensitive information disclosure or unauthorized data access. This integration promotes a secure data ecosystem, safeguarding confidential data and maintaining compliance with data protection regulations. 

Steps to Implement Power BI and ChatGPT 

 Implementing Power BI and ChatGPT integration involves a series of steps. Here’s a step-by-step guide for you. 

1. Preparing Your Data for Integration  

Start by identifying the relevant data sources that you want to integrate into Power BI. Ensure that the data is clean, structured, and well-prepared for analysis. This may involve data cleansing, transformation, and consolidation to ensure accuracy and consistency. Additionally, consider the security and privacy aspects of your data, ensuring that any sensitive information is properly protected and anonymized.

2. Setting up Power BI Integration

Begin by accessing the Power BI platform and creating a new project or opening an existing one. Familiarize yourself with the Power BI interface and the available tools for data visualization and analysis. Connect your data sources to Power BI by establishing appropriate data connections, such as importing data from files, databases, or cloud-based platforms. Ensure that the data sources are properly configured and updated to reflect the latest information.

3. Integrating ChatGPT into Power BI 

This can be achieved by leveraging the capabilities of the ChatGPT API or utilizing a pre-built ChatGPT integration solution specifically designed for Power BI. Consult the documentation or resources provided by the ChatGPT provider for instructions on how to integrate the model with Power BI. Configure the integration settings, establish the necessary connections, and ensure that the integration is properly implemented within the Power BI environment.

4. Testing and Refining the Integration

Engage with the ChatGPT interface within Power BI, interact with the data, and validate the responses provided by ChatGPT. Test various scenarios, ask different types of questions, and analyze the generated insights to ensure they align with your expectations. Gather feedback from users and stakeholders, and iterate on the integration if necessary, making refinements to enhance the user experience and the quality of insights delivered. 

Best Practices for Successful Implementation  

To ensure a successful implementation of Power BI and ChatGPT integration, consider the following best practices: 
  • Clearly define the goals and objectives of integrating Power BI and ChatGPT. Determine the specific use cases, desired outcomes, and metrics for success. 
  • Engage key stakeholders and users throughout the implementation process. Seek their input, address their concerns, and involve them in testing and validation. 
  • Provide comprehensive training and resources to users to familiarize them with the integrated solution. Offer guidance on how to effectively utilize the ChatGPT capabilities within Power BI. 
  • Monitor and analyze the performance of the integration. Regularly assess the impact, user adoption, and value delivered by the integrated solution. 
  • Stay updated with the latest updates and advancements in Power BI and ChatGPT. Leverage new features, enhancements, and integrations to further enhance the capabilities and benefits of the integration. 

Challenges and Concerns 

Let us guide you through these challenges and concerns, providing insights and strategies to overcome them effectively during the implementation of Power BI and ChatGPT integration.

1. Data Security and Privacy 

The exchange of data between platforms introduces potential vulnerabilities that need to be safeguarded. It is essential to implement robust security measures, such as encryption protocols and access controls, to protect sensitive information from unauthorized access or breaches. Additionally, organizations must adhere to data privacy regulations and ensure compliance with relevant standards to maintain customer trust and legal compliance.

2. Ethical AI Usage 

ChatGPT relies on training data that may contain biases or reflect human prejudices. Organizations need to be proactive in addressing these biases to ensure fair and unbiased outcomes. This involves careful data curation, regular monitoring of the model’s performance, and implementing bias detection and mitigation techniques. Furthermore, businesses should establish guidelines for responsible AI usage, including transparency, accountability, and user consent, to ensure ethical practices are followed throughout the integration. 

3. Overcoming Bias and Accuracy Issues

ChatGPT’s responses are based on pre-existing data, which can lead to biased or inaccurate information. Organizations should continuously evaluate the performance of the integration, identify potential biases or inaccuracies, and take corrective actions. This may involve diversifying training data sources, incorporating feedback loops, and conducting regular audits. By actively addressing bias and accuracy issues, organizations can enhance the reliability and trustworthiness of the insights generated by the integrated solution.  Addressing these challenges and considerations is vital to maximizing its benefits while minimizing risks. It is also important to keep in mind that this powerful combination is not designed to replace humans but rather to work in synergy with human expertise for more efficient and impactful decision-making. Hence, a comprehensive strategy to harness its combined power with confidence, drive informed decision-making and achieve meaningful business outcomes is crucial.